我正在尝试使用Terraform启动虚拟机。它运作良好,但是会导致Chef扩展程序的安装出现问题。
代码中提供的Chef验证密钥以前已在我的其他服务器上使用。现在有了这个,当我在terraform_prod.tfvars中注释我的Chef_validation_key时,它可以让我运行计划,但是当我取消注释厨师键时,则会出现错误
错误:module.windows-vm.azurerm_virtual_machine_extension.chef_agent:“ protected_settings”包含无效的JSON:字符串文字中的无效字符“ \ n”
它应该能够运行计划并以天蓝色启动服务器。